‘Playing For Poverty’ Presented At Fulton Lions Meeting
Heather Sturges, (left), outreach specialist for Oswego County Opportunities Crisis and Development Services, was guest speaker at the Sept. 8 Fulton Lions Club meeting. James Sokolowski, Fulton club president, thanks Sturges for her presentation. Sturges spoke about Playing For Poverty, a fund raising event whose mission is to raise awareness about poverty in Oswego County and homeless youth.
